DIY Buzz Wire Game Using Transistor

    Today’s video is about fun activities. You must have played the popular buzz wire game in a fair. Today, you will learn how to build your own buzz wire game using one transistor.

    Components Required:

    1) BC547 Transistor
    2) 1K Ohm and 300Ohm Resistance
    3) 100uF Capacitor
    4) Bread Board
    5) Bare Copper Wire
    6) Jumper Wires
    7) 5V Plus Breadboard Power Supply
    8) Buzzer

    Steps to Follow

    1. Connect the breadboard with the Breadboard power supply gadget.
    2. Construct the BuzzWire and attach it to the stands. After that, connect the Trigger that you will hold with your hand.
    3. Connect one Point of the Buzz Wire to VCC. Then, connect the trigger to a 1K Resistor in the breadboard.
    4. Connect Pin 3 to Ground and Pin2 to the other side of the 1K Resistor.
    5. Connect the Positive of the LED to Vcc, the negative of the LED to a 300Ohm Resistance and the other point of the Resistance to Pin1 of BC547.
    6. Connect the Positive of the Buzzer to Vcc and the Negative of Buzzer to Pin1 of BC547
    7. Check all the wiring. If all is well, let’s Power up the system.
